MAESTRALE RS (UPDATED)
The newly refined MAESTRALE RS is SCARPA's most powerful alpine touring boot, engineered for expert backcountry skiers who refuse to sacrifice descent performance for uphill efficiency. Built on a 101mm last with a Grilamid® shell and Pebax® Rnew® cuff, it delivers a 130 Flex stiffness profile that drives hard-charging turns with the authority of an alpine boot, while the Speed Lock 4 walk mechanism unlocks a full range of motion for long, demanding ascents. The redesigned four-buckle closure with Booster® Active Power Strap wraps the foot in a uniform, high-tension hold that eliminates micro-movement and maximizes energy transfer in every condition. Compatible with both Tech and AT bindings, the MAESTRALE RS is the boot for skiers who push hard in both directions.
- Flex 130 Grilamid® Shell + Pebax® Rnew® Cuff — High-performance shell and bio-based cuff combination delivers expert-level stiffness and powerful rebound, so aggressive skiers can drive turns with full confidence
- Speed Lock 4 Walk Mode — Four-position walk mechanism with 19° forward lean range provides unrestricted, natural stride on demanding ascents without compromising downhill rigidity
- Intuition® Pro Flex Performance Liner — Thermoformable performance liner heat-molds to your foot for a precise, high-energy fit that holds its shape across full days of hard skiing
- 4-Buckle + Booster® Active Power Strap — Redesigned four-buckle closure with active power strap delivers a uniform, high-tension hold that eliminates heel lift and maximizes power transfer on every turn
- AT + TLT Dual Binding Compatibility — Works seamlessly with both Tech and AT bindings, giving expert skiers the freedom to pair the MAESTRALE RS with their preferred setup

All SCARPA ski boots use Mondo sizing.
SCARPA ski boots break on the half size, this means that a half size shares the same shell length as the whole size above it but the liners are lasted for each 1/2 size. For example, a 25.5 and 26.0 are the same shell size but the respective liners come pre-molded to the half size.
Some skiers may want to downsize up to 1 full Mondo size, depending upon personal preference.
